Output 840796061a0d0d2dab9da3c1a5aa41a2c6076dccbf58a0ec673b90bbe8edc35c:7

value
558166
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b707ae4d799df437e36445b2db0acd8b285d123 OP_EQUAL
address
3Jn72fep7z4PoyihYH4tQRL3wqJdo3gxi6
transaction
840796061a0d0d2dab9da3c1a5aa41a2c6076dccbf58a0ec673b90bbe8edc35c
spent
true